A traffic collision on Interstate 8 West in La Mesa, CA, caused significant disruptions during the morning commute today. The incident, which involved three vehicles, including a black Toyota 2-door and a black Ford Focus, occurred around 7:49 AM. As a result of the crash, one lane was blocked, leading to delays and congestion in the fast lanes.
Emergency services responded promptly to manage the scene and facilitate the clearing of the roadway. A tow truck was called to assist in removing the vehicles involved in the traffic incident. By 8:32 AM, efforts were underway to restore normal traffic flow, but motorists were still experiencing backups due to the earlier blockage.
